An apparatus is provided for the concentration of solar energy in a panel from a large receiving surface to a small emitting region. An optical element array directs incident sunlight by total internal reflection through a series of apertures where the light is laterally propagated between two mirrored surfaces to a region for harvesting by a solar energy collector such as a photo-voltaic cell or heat absorbent material. The optical element array and mirrored surfaces can be made extremely thin. The invention can advantageously reduce the size, weight and cost of the panel. Further the lateral propagation of concentrated light in an air medium reduces light absorption by the apparatus material resulting in less heat buildup.
